August Rainfall and Precipitation in Central Puerto Rico

Average rainfall, rainy days and the driest cities in Central Puerto Rico, Puerto Rico in August.

Central Puerto Rico, Puerto Rico, a region in Puerto Rico, experiences precipitation in August ranging from moderate in Rincon (77 mm (3 in)) to high in Utuado (123 mm (4.8 in)).

Central Puerto Rico precipitation in August: frequently asked questions

How much rainfall does Central Puerto Rico, Puerto Rico receive in August?

In August, Rincon typically receives modest rainfall, around 77 mm (3 in), making this a relatively dry month.

How many days does it rain in Central Puerto Rico, Puerto Rico in August?

Rainfall in Rincon typically falls on roughly 18 days days in August.

Is August part of the rainy season in Central Puerto Rico, Puerto Rico?

Not really. August is outside the wettest stretch of the year in Central Puerto Rico, Puerto Rico.

What is the wettest city in August in Central Puerto Rico, Puerto Rico?

In our database, Utuado stands out as having an average rainfall level of 123 mm (4.8 in), making it the wettest location.

What is the driest city in August in Central Puerto Rico, Puerto Rico?

The driest place is Rincon with an average rainfall of 77 mm (3 in) according to our data.
